The Retirement Plan Advisor helps individuals plan for a successful retirement through group and individual presentations to new and existing defined contribution 401(k)/(a), 403(b), and/or Government 457 plan participants across plan sizes. This role uses data-driven analysis to lead conversations with participants, meets client service level agreements, and achieves annual targets. The position also supports Relationship Management in establishing and maintaining relationships with key stakeholders within the assigned territory.

This Advisor will work with plan participants on the West Coast and bilingual Spanish skills are required.

Occasional travel is required between Colorado and California.

What you will do
  • Conduct Retirement Readiness Reviews and other individual meetings and group presentations with targeted participants using consultative expertise to improve retirement outcomes

  • Develop and maintain strategic partnerships with key stakeholders for each location within the assigned territory or for assigned employer-sponsored plans

  • Conduct one-on-one virtual and on-site group meetings using various technologies in a professional manner

  • Manage meeting schedules, including travel booking

  • Create and execute dynamic business plans and tactics to drive positive retirement income objectives for participants

  • Document interactions in Salesforce and collect required information to adhere to regulatory guidelines

  • Achieve plan-level and individual goals to meet service level agreements and business results

  • Participate in client meetings, sales finals, or other external meetings as needed

  • Work collaboratively across internal service and management teams to improve effectiveness

What you will bring
  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ent work experience in lieu of a degree

  • 3–5 years of relevant financial services experience

  • Spanish bilingual skills required

  • Strong presentation skills required

  • Proficiency in M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Teams required

  • Strategic thinker who can work independently

  • Strong relationship-building and territory-management skills

  • FINRA Series 6, 63, 65 registrations required within established timeline; current FINRA registrations strongly preferred

  • FINRA fingerprinting required upon hire

What will set you apart
  • Working knowledge of Salesforce preferred

  • Working knowledge of building blocks for successful retirement planning preferred

  • Basic understanding of defined contribution plans preferred

  • Practical experience providing high-level, consultative client interactions preferred
